# Refactoring
A refactor changes structure while behavior stays identical. The moment
behavior changes on purpose, it is a feature; by accident, a bug. Keep the
line sharp.
## Method
1. **Secure the net first.** Confirm the tests around the target pass and
actually pin its behavior. If coverage is thin, write characterization
tests *before* touching anything: capture what the code does now, even
its oddities. An odd behavior may be load-bearing.
2. **Name the smell and the target shape.** "Three near-copies of this
query builder → one function with two parameters." If you cannot state
the after-state in a sentence, you are wandering, not refactoring.
3. **Move in reversible steps, green after each.** Rename; extract function;
inline; move; then delete the old path. Each step compiles, passes, and
could ship. Twenty two-minute steps beat one two-hour rewrite in every
dimension that matters: reviewability, bisectability, abort-ability.
4. **Separate refactor commits from behavior commits.** A reviewer must be
able to skim a refactor commit ("no behavior change") and scrutinize the
small behavior commit. Mixed commits get neither reading.
5. **Follow the house style,** even where you prefer another. A codebase
with one accent is maintainable; your improvement in a foreign accent is
someone else's cleanup ticket.
